Abstract

The Parental lines Mordan and E.C. 376187 had significant positive gca effect for flower head size, seed index and grain yield but Mordan showed negative gca for days to flowering and maturity in sunflower. The line EC 376235 exhibited significant positive gca effect for seed filling percentage and grain yield but negative gca effect for days to maturity and flower head size. The parents EC 37786, EC 376235 and Mordan showed significant positive gca effect for oil content. The cross combinations EC 376235 × Mordan and EC 37785 × Mordan showed significant negative sca effects for days to flowering as well as maturity i.e. the good combiners for earliness. The cross combinations EC 376187 × EC 376217 and EC 37785 × Mordan had significant positive sca effect for grain yield and its contributing charaters i.e. flower head size, seed filling and seed index. The crosses (EC 376216 × Mordan), (EC 376235 × EC 376217), (EC 376187 × EC 376234), (EC 37785 × Mordan) and (EC 376216 × EC 376235) were good combiners for oil percentage.
